For me it was still the Anderson and Rousey KOs. As someone who only started really paying attention to MMA last year, is Bisping one of those guys you'd have to have been following for a while to understand why it was so big?

Basically yes. Before he got his short-notice title fight, Bisping was known as the guy who would go on a 3-4 fight win streak and then lose in a #1 contender fight. He was synonymous with "Best fighter to have never fought for a UFC title in his whole career" even while he was still active.

threeagainstfour
Jun 27, 2005


CommonShore posted:

Basically yes. Before he got his short-notice title fight, Bisping was known as the guy who would go on a 3-4 fight win streak and then lose in a #1 contender fight. He was synonymous with "Best fighter to have never fought for a UFC title in his whole career" even while he was still active.

Also Rockhold had already soundly beaten Bisping a year or two before the rematch.

So Bisping was coming in on two weeks notice, against a guy with size and reach on him who had already finished him pretty handily. No one gave the guy a shot, but also I don't think anyone thought Rockhold would abandon most of his advantages and try to KO Bisping in spectacular fashion, only to get knocked spectacularly knocked out himself.

For me it was still the Anderson and Rousey KOs. As someone who only started really paying attention to MMA last year, is Bisping one of those guys you'd have to have been following for a while to understand why it was so big?

Bisping was the epitome of a gatekeeper, someone who stayed fairly consistent and could beat lovely or flawed fighters but lost to every deservedly top 10 guy he ever fought. Prior to Rockhold, his best win was probably Brian Stann and his best performance was losing to Chael Sonnen on short notice. He had pretty good cardio, volume, takedown defenseband foot work, but wasn't remarkable at any other area of fighting. On top of that, he's been fighting for over a decade, his eye injury put him out for a year and gives him lingering minor vision problems and that cardio that has historically been among his only strengths may be waning based on his last few fights (some minor speculation abounds if that's just him getting old or if getting off/on fewer PEDs is the culprit) so he was considered to be be in his decline. He also had no power of note due to the way he's constantly on his feet when striking, all of his tkos were either volume accumulation to extremely gassed opponents or blatant illegal strikes.

So this pillow fisted old guy who was on his first win streak in like four years and held a ufc record for most wins without a title shot came in on short notice against a bigger, younger, stronger, more athletic champion who had previously effortlessly destroyed him, and proceeded to knock him the gently caress out in the first round. Yeah, it's legitimately the biggest upset of the year over Diaz beating McGregor.
